5

October

Love’s Shadow Lately the subject of my thought is time:How time flows like a river, if it does,Or like a house of crystal, stands immobile,Or ceases where the very smallest creaturesDance without houses, clocks, or bankless streams. Here is my birthday, carried round againBy the tall star-crossed cycles of the moon.Love’s shadow brightens as the day beginsAnd then grows longer, whether we believeThat time is real or just a dream of things.

6

Ode to the Butterflies

Spinoza says you’re pure theology: O crazy butterflies aloftDrinking the last of autumn’s flower-wine, as if you thoughtThere’s no tomorrow, as if chicory, vetch and daisiesWeren’t on their long last legs, as if the field and forestMammals weren’t headed underground, as if the coldestSpells won’t cast themselves on us before October’s over.But party, party, party! Spinoza says you’re somehowCutouts of God’s great fabric—matter—divine confetti Thrown necessarily up in just these handfuls that I seeRight here, right now, and so am I, this slower bodyEarthbound as you distractingly, disarmingly, are not.Mode of the same sweet attribute, just one amidst an infinite,Uncountable swarm. So we are all eternal, little buddies!Succession is illusion, look: the sheer cloud-shadow stipple,Breezes that shake the goldenrod, your upward-gusting trios,We’re all in this together and like God we’re always here!

7

First Piano Lesson

For Leslie Beers

For years they have been pressing the white keys,Sometimes the black, occasionally, haphazardlyGreat fingerfuls together. But whereExactly was the music, they wondered? Gone.

Today they built a bridge from C to GAs if across Giverny’s garden pond.Perhaps it is a rainbow? G to C,Aural, slant-visible, inevitable, clear.

They stand amazed around the grand pianoCapable at last of lifting upFrom sound’s long restlessness the drippingGlittery net of intervals and in its knotted strings

That golden fish, a song!

8

Among Cosmologists

For Sarah Shandera

Breathlessly, with a shrug and a vague gesture,Empty hand palm up, collecting somethingFrom empty space that is by all accountsNot empty, rather like the four-dimensionalSurface of an n-dimensional cauldronWhere bubbles form and wink out of existence,The young expert on galaxies suggests,“A hundred billion?” However the next SloanSurvey announces the count of galaxies—Red-shifting as they leave us past the tallImplacable vast light cone we cannot seeBut know it marks the boundaries of seeing.

“Doesn’t it keep you up at night, this outwardRush of galaxies fleeing themselves and usInto the infinite arms of the multiverse?”I ask. “Oh, no,” she answers, catching her breath.“What keeps me up is our recurrent failureTo know the universe before inflation,Or offer quantum mechanics a foundation.It’s not the future, but the hidden past.It’s not what’s overhead, but underneath.”

9

The Always Coming On

The sun is closing in on the horizon,Light pocks the highway like a rain of gold,And I rush through at seventy, seventy-five.My husband sees me squint and asks, perhaps,His baseball cap might help? But I persistIn blocking out the lightfall with my fist,When suddenly the road shifts north northwest,The hills get higher and the sun eclipses.Those lines return: how swift, how secretlyThe shadow of the night comes on. MacLeish.

He sailed to Persia in the nineteen-twenties,A diplomat who hoped to help dismantleThe opium trade, but fruitlessly. He leftBewitched, recalling afterward the spellOnset of evening cast across the desert,Great vistas of time and space, of dynasties,So swiftly, silently engulfed, and thenOnly the nomads with their tents and fires.

I have to turn the headlights on.The hills’ deep emerald fades to blue,The sky’s cerulean edge to mauve;My hair falls sideways past my nape,White as a ghost, and just as thin.I have to turn the headlights onTo see how far the highway goes,To pierce the darkness, secret, swift,The wayward evening, losing lightAnd warmth, direction, solace, home.

10

Where the Wild Things Are

The fields around my country house are sownWith soy and corn. Though corn is fringed and bearded,Sways with the wind and shudders, speaking in tongues,Its husks and stalks a sheer archaic murmur, lostTo living memory but able to haunt us still,And soy is low and green and generally silent,They’re the main crops that cash out for our farmers.So we can’t blame the farmers; they have to live.

And here and there a browsing cow or twoMunches through yellowing hayfields, which distractsThe eye with color and barnstorms the nose.Yet all in all the crops are sad, and boring:They won’t feed hungry children or restless piglets,Only the international lust for energy in anyForm, at any cost, a kind of chlorophyllic burn.That’s why, when I go walking across the valley,

I’ve learned to stick to weedy border farm roads,Hard to pursue, reverting to vetch or bramble:Those roads where wilderness asserts itselfIn miniature, where clouded sulphurs clusterNear puddles, and those butterflies we like to callCoppers, purples, blues, bits of the visible spectrumLighter than air, go tumbling over the clover,And mingle with satyrs, nymphs, and painted ladies!

November

November

For Dick Davis

My friend, it seems as if we know at lastWe won’t be here much longer.Crossing the mountain of a hundred yearsWe’ve gained the shadow side. Against our facesBoreas falls, the breath of nothingness.

The Chinese sages recommend reflection:Characters like willowsBend to the river where cold water flowsUnceasingly, changing its fluid mindWith every passing cloud or boat or leaf.

What’s left behind? Only a few brief verses.Come to visit soon, and drink a glassOf wine and watch the woods behind my houseDecant the autumn moonOverblown and gold on the horizon.
